Send us Fan MailWondering how to safely and effectively program plyometrics for your patients? In this episode, we’re breaking down the essential factors to consider when designing plyometric training. We’ll start with a quick refresher on what plyometrics are, then dive into how to make exercises sport-specific, the importance of assessing skill levels, and the factors that increase exercise intensity. We’ll also cover best practices for recovery times and work-to-rest ratios, plus some key considerations for working with both youth and masters athletes.
